Hi there.  We are very frequent RCCL cruisers, but we've never sailed on the Icon.  We are planning back-to-back Icon cruises (Eastern/Western Caribbean) in late February/early March.  We obviously wanted to have the same cabin for both sailings, ideally. And we don't want to do the infinity balcony, so we are only focusing on the large ocean view balcony category.  By the time we started looking, only VERY aft large ocean view balcony cabins were available (we usually choose mid-ship).  We ended up holding 11750, which is the very last aft cabin before it switches over to the wake-facing suites (i.e. it's right next to a sunset suite that faces the wake).  It would be the same as 11350 on the other side if you're looking at the Icon deck 11 deck plan.  Has anyone ever sailed in either one of these cabins?  I guess I'm suspicious because it's still available so I'm worried it's super bad!  I would appreciate any experiences/thoughts/counsel!  Thanks in advance!

I sailed in the cabin right above on deck 12.  Enjoy the balcony and the view...both are fabulous.  It would be a long walk for some though.
